Role Overview
Our Core Commercial team is seeking exceptional college students for our Summer Internship Program, which provides meaningful opportunities for personal and professional growth, as well as rewarding career path options. This internship provides a dynamic opportunity to gain field experience in insurance risk solutions while contributing to strategic projects that enhance safety, risk evaluation, and client service delivery. As a Field Intern, you will collaborate with Risk Solutions Consultants and cross-functional teams to support initiatives that improve tools, processes, and insights used in risk analysis and mitigation.
Responsibilities
- Researching and applying technical information to support current Risk Solutions service efforts
- Attending co-surveys with experienced Risk Solutions staff to learn and develop technical and consulting skills
- Completing Capstone project and presentation to senior management on a relevant Risk Solutions topic (possibly involving innovation and the use of technology to help improve Risk Solutions efficiencies)
- Assisting with the research and development of draft Risk Solutions support resources
- Assisting field consultants with pre-visit preparation work including account research
- Developing account loss trend analyses
- Following-up with customers to gain commitment to move forward with field consultant recommended services such as water/temperature sensors, IR thermography/vibration testing, drone survey, wearable technology sensors, slip meter testing and fleet telematics
- Following-up on the status of open Recommendations by calling customers, answering questions, aiding as needed, and entering notes into our loss control system
- Assisting Technical Directors and AVPs with assigned projects
- Create and present a final presentation to management and leadership members at the close of the internship program highlighting the work you accomplished throughout the summer
